What is the typical cost of preschool in Colony, OK, and are there any financial assistance programs available?

In Colony and the surrounding rural areas, preschool costs can vary, but many in-home or church-based programs may range from $100 to $250 per month for part-time care. For financial assistance, Oklahoma's Department of Human Services (DHS) offers subsidy programs for qualifying families, and some local providers may offer sliding scale fees. It's also worth checking with specific programs about potential scholarships or sibling discounts.

How can I verify the quality and licensing of a preschool in a small town like Colony?

All licensed childcare facilities in Oklahoma, including preschools, are regulated by DHS. You can use the Oklahoma Child Care Locator online tool to search for licensed providers in or near Colony and view their licensing history, including any compliance reports. For smaller, license-exempt programs (like some church-run Mother's Day Out programs), directly ask about their staff qualifications, safety protocols, and curriculum.

Are there any state-funded pre-K programs available for 4-year-olds in Colony?

Colony itself is served by the Canadian Public Schools district. Oklahoma's state-funded pre-K program is available through public schools for eligible 4-year-olds. You should contact Canadian Elementary School directly to inquire about enrollment availability, eligibility requirements (which can include age and residency), and whether transportation is provided from the Colony area.

What should I look for regarding safety and preparedness at a preschool in a rural Oklahoma community?

Key safety factors include verified emergency plans for severe weather common to Oklahoma (like tornadoes), secure pick-up/drop-off procedures, and staff training in CPR/first aid. For preparedness, inquire about the learning environment and how it balances play with foundational skills like letter recognition, which aligns with Oklahoma's Early Learning Guidelines. A quality program should have a structured daily routine and clear communication with parents.

Understanding what a quality Pre-K 3 program looks like can help you navigate your search. At this age, the best learning happens through structured play and social interaction. Look for environments where children are encouraged to explore, ask questions, and develop their burgeoning independence. A strong program will focus on building social skills like sharing and taking turns, fostering early language and vocabulary through storytime and conversation, and introducing basic concepts like colors, shapes, and numbers in a hands-on way. In Colony, you'll find that many programs emphasize this balanced approach, knowing that these formative years are critical for emotional and cognitive development.

As you begin your local search, think beyond just proximity. While finding a school close to home is a practical concern for busy families, consider scheduling visits to a couple of places. When you visit, observe the classroom atmosphere. Is it warm and inviting? Do the teachers get down on the children's level and speak with kindness and encouragement? Ask about the daily routine; it should have a predictable flow that includes time for free play, group activities, outdoor time, and rest. Don't hesitate to ask about the teachers' qualifications and their experience with three-year-olds specifically.
